Boxer From Shantung (1972, HK) is a Martial Arts film directed by Chang Cheh & Bauu Hok Lai.

Plot Summary

  • Leaving the poverty of his life in Shantung to seek fortune in Shanghai, The Boxer is instead drawn into a world of corruption, gang warfare and evil... Where his only protection is his famed fighting technique.
